Want to discover Natura Ecological Park at your own pace? Feel free to skip the guided tour and create your own itinerary for a perfect day with family and friends in the park. Simply purchase a day pass, grab a map, and set off to explore the trails and habitats.
An ecological park day pass gives you access to all of the natural habitats that are home to Costa Rica’s crawling, colourful, and cool creatures.
Hike along rainforest paths that lead to different habitats. Check out the turtle pond and crocodile lake for a glimpse at creatures that look prehistoric! Interested in Costa Rica frogs? Arenal Natura is home to the country’s largest frog garden! Hop on over and take a peek.
Keep an eye out for colourful birds that fly high above you and admire brightly coloured butterflies and delicate orchids on this bio-adventure that’s perfect for all ages.
